Benelli 752 S 2020

If you like Italian design and the design language of MV Agusta's Brutale series in particular, you will find the Benelli 752 S a particularly stylish partner. The setup of the suspension and braking system is very well done, and the riding position is comfortably upright - in other words, it meets the standard you would expect on a modern mid-range naked bike. The engine's acceleration is also mediocre; more could certainly be achieved by revising the injection electronics. On the other hand, the features of the Benelli 752 S would fit into a higher class, with LED lighting all round, a fat USD fork and even a TFT colour display, it makes quite an impression.
Ducati Monster 1100 Evo 2011

The Monster 1100 Evo remains an honest naked bike in the best Bolognese tradition, despite a dispensable amount of electronic gadgetry. It is not only the most beautiful "New Monster", but also the fastest. With 100 hp and 105 Nm, the inner values are just as balanced as the outer ones.
